New belts and alternator = "clunk" sound when first accelerating

I installed a new alternator, new battery, and new belts last night. Tension feels right (about 1/2" flex). The belts don't squeal or squeek, but when I put my car in either drive or reverse, when I first hit the gas pedal I hear a light "clunk, clunk, clunk" ... as if the belts are catching/rubbing.

Any ideas?

When I replaced my alternator I had used the new retainer for the upper mounting bolt which caused the alternator to vibrator wildly. After going in and completely removng the alternator and replacing the original retainer from the old alternator it worked perfectly:
